Practical session on migration from VAT to GST being held for MSMEs in Kolkata
Kolkata, Nov 30 (KNN) The Directorate of Commercial Taxes, West Bengal, is holding a practical session of transition from VAT system to GST system for MSMEs on December 1, 2016.
Nandini Ghosh, Senior Joint Commissioner Commercial Taxes, WBCTS, Directorate of Commercial Taxes (FR) will make a technical presentation on Migration from VAT to GST System.
Industry body FOSMI is facilitating the meeting for the representatives handling the tax matters from its member MSME units.
The Goods & Services Tax Network (GSTN) has started migrating existing VAT payers into GST system to allot a provisional Identification Number.
The Directorate of Commercial Taxes, West Bengal, in a letter to the industry associations has said that the dealers registered under the West Bengal Value Added Tax Act, 2003, would be able to log into GST common web portal and furnish required information for GST enrolment from November 30, 2016 to December 15, 2016.
Several presentations have already been made by the department at several places outside Kolkata for different stake-holders. (KNN Bureau)
